PHP xml_get_current_byte_index() Function
Complete PHP XML Reference
Definition and Usage
The xml_get_current_byte_index() function gets the byte index for
an XML parser.
This function returns the current byte index on success, or FALSE on
failure.
Syntax
|
xml_get_current_byte_index(parser)
|
| Parameter |
Description |
| parser |
Required. Specifies XML parser to use |
Example
<?php
//invalid xml file
$xmlfile = 'test.xml';
$xmlparser = xml_parser_create();
// open a file and read data
$fp = fopen($xmlfile, 'r');
while ($xmldata = fread($fp, 4096))
{
// parse the data chunk
if (!xml_parse($xmlparser,$xmldata,feof($fp)))
{
die( print "ERROR: "
. xml_error_string(xml_get_error_code($xmlparser))
. "<br />"
. "Line: "
. xml_get_current_line_number($xmlparser)
. "<br />"
. "Column: "
. xml_get_current_column_number($xmlparser)
. "<br />"
. "Byte Index: "
. xml_get_current_byte_index($xmlparser)
. "<br />");
}
}
xml_parser_free($xmlparser);
?>
|
The output of the code above could be:
ERROR: Mismatched tag
Line: 5
Column: 41
Byte Index: 72
